Power

A treadmill is a costly home fitness equipment that requires regular maintenance. It also consumes energy when being used. It is therefore important to consider the amount a treadmill is going cost you over its lifetime. A treadmill that is used for just one hour of running will consume approximately 1.5 Kilowatt-hours worth of electricity. To cut down on the amount of energy consumed it is best to leave it unplugged when you are not being used. You should select an exercise machine with a low energy rating.

AC motors or DC motors are able to power treadmills. The kind of motor your treadmill uses will determine the power consumption as well as the speed it operates at. AC motors tend to be more powerful, but also louder. DC motors require less maintenance and are quieter.

The settings you choose will also affect the power consumption of your treadmill. Walking speed settings on most treadmills use less power than running speed settings. The treadmill will consume more power if you set it at an incline. This is especially when it's set to an incline that is steep.

Some treadmills come with built-in workout programs that alter the speed and incline of the treadmill automatically. These preset programs can help you reach your fitness goals. They include high-intensity training intervals, weight loss exercises and distance runs. These programs can help you reduce calories, improve your heart health and more.

The age of your treadmill can also affect the amount of electricity consumed. Most electrical appliances use more power as they get older, which is why it's crucial to check and maintain your treadmill regularly to ensure that the components are in good condition.

It's important to know that many treadmills draw power even when they're not in use. It's important to unplug your treadmill when you aren't making use of it, or at a minimum turn the power switch off. You can also install a smart electric foldable treadmill plug that will turn off your treadmill when it's not in use.

Apps

Many treadmills have apps that can provide guidance and motivation to the user. There are a range of options available, with higher-priced apps tending to offer more video classes streaming as well as advanced exercises.

For example for instance, the iFit app provides trainer-led workouts in some of the most epic locations around the world. You can run on the official Boston Marathon course, through Central Park in New York City or even on a Kenyan elephant safari as you work out. It offers a variety exercises, including guided workouts in cardio, yoga, and strength training.

Other apps can be used in conjunction with an electric treadmill, for example Nike's Running Club. The free app tracks your progress as you train, and it offers a variety of different training routines, from beginner plans to high-intensity advanced exercises. Certain workouts make use of audio and music to guide you through the workout while others show visual representations of your heart rate on the screen.

Another alternative is the fitness app that is virtual Zwift. This popular indoor cycling platform has widened its scope to treadmill running this year. You play as an avatar and explore surreal virtual or real worlds. You can also compete in private or public races with other players from all over the world. This is an excellent way to spend time and the game-like feel can make treadmill running easier.

You can also use the Kinomap app to create an immersive and interactive running experience on your treadmill. Connect the app to your treadmill via Bluetooth or a speed-sensor (like the ones in some models of running watches) and run as the scenery changes on your tablet or smartphone. The app can take you into a zombie apocalypse, where the virtual avatar of your character is being chased by a horde of animated creatures as you ramp up your speed to escape.
